Enhanced quantum sensing of gravitational acceleration constant

quant-ph · 2025-06-25 · conditional · novelty 4.0

Delocalized quantum probes in free fall can estimate g with a quantum Fisher information that grows quadratically with the wavepacket separation, and position measurements retain a useful fraction of this bound.
